Assign different color in same section of Chord diagram in R

Hi all,

I'm making a chord diagram in R, and have question on assigning color. You can easily replicate with my code below. What I'm trying to do is to assign two different color in same section.

set.seed(999)
mat = matrix(sample(18, 18), 3, 6) 
rownames(mat) = paste0("S", 1:3)
colnames(mat) = paste0("E", 1:6)

col_mat = rand_color(length(mat), transparency = 0.5)
dim(col_mat) = dim(mat)
chordDiagram(mat, grid.col = grid.col, col = col_mat)

If you run my code, I get value of 8 for E4 of the column and S2 of the row, and plot shows only single flow with single color. What I want to do here is to seperate them into two colors (e.g. black and yellow) in order to show even though they belong to same pair (E4-S2), they are originated from different location (e.g. E4(from US)-S2 -- Black, E4(from Russia)-S2 -- Yellow).

Any brilliant idea to show this would be welcome! Thank you in advance
